Martin Wroe   ∙   3 min read   ∙   View on Medium The Struggle For The Legal Tender On the disappearance of cash and what money can, and cannot, measure. Standing in a slow-moving supermarket queue this week, everyone was getting a little impatient. The customer being served was having trouble paying for her shopping. Very slowly she was drawing from her purse round bits of metal and pieces of folded paper. Hard cash. The episode was awkward but also endearing, a clumsy antique moment in our sleek and shiny digital times. Our pockets and purses jangle less and less every day. Almost without noticing cash is disappearing in favour of one-tap transactions with card or phone. Life becomes quicker, more convenient…but also, depending on who you are, more difficult. Especially for people on low incomes. According to a report from consumer group  Which,  half of regular cash users say that using cash helps them keep track of their spending… and more are turning to cash as the cost of living

Martin Wroe Following May 1 · 3 min read · Listen Save Time Travelling When there’s no substitute for the body language of presence. I travelled back in time last week. A friend texted from New York and asked me to send best wishes to another friend — let’s call him Jack. The text landed on me like a punch because Jack died last year but my friend in New York hadn’t heard. It was as if he was living in an earlier time. In his world Jack was still alive. Jack had not been a fan of social media, so when he died his partner asked that the news was not posted online. This meant people learned of his death when a relative, or family friend like me, rang, or wrote, to tell them. I spoke to a lot of people, and each time it helped me to understand more of my own loss. Waiting in silence as people received the news… the loss of words, lump in the throat, tear in the eye.
